First, do your research. It is incredibly important to do your research when looking for a plumbing service. In order to get the best care and results, it is essential to be sure that you are selecting a company with skilled technicians who can handle any issue that may arise. Knowing the company’s qualifications, specializations, reviews from past clients, and experience level are all essential in finding the perfect fit for your needs. Not only should you make sure that their rates are affordable, but also consider if they offer any warranties or guarantees on their workmanship.

Additionally, if you have any questions about installation or maintenance of plumbing systems, make sure to ask the company before signing a contract. Lastly, it is always advised to check out local licensing requirements as some states require specific certifications or permits for plumbers working within their jurisdictions. Taking the time to thoroughly research each potential plumbing service will ensure that your job is done right and that you receive quality results without having to worry about potential problems down the line.

It’s important to know exactly what their qualifications are so you can make an informed decision when selecting a company. Ask them if they offer any guarantees on their work or if they provide free estimates before beginning work on your home or business’s plumbing system. Additionally, inquire about any available discounts or warranties being offered by the companies so you can save money in the long run as well as get quality services without needing repairs soon after hiring them.

When evaluating different plumbers, consider how quickly they respond to inquiries and whether they seem knowledgeable about the work being done. A reputable plumbing service should be prompt in returning calls and answering questions thoroughly and professionally. Furthermore, look into whether or not they have adequate insurance coverage in case something goes wrong while on-site working on your property’s plumbing system – this protects both parties involved and ensures that no one is liable for any damages that may occur due to faulty repairs or negligence when handling the job at hand.

Finally, don’t forget to ask for references from past customers before committing to hire anyone – this will help ensure that whoever you select has been reliable in providing quality services previously and would be able to do so with your project as well. When looking into these references, make note of things like customer satisfaction, timeliness of completing projects within budget constraints etc., so that you can assess a potential contractor appropriately against these standards before making up your mind about who to hire.
